- 博客(57)
- 收藏
- 关注
转载 关于BINARY的使用
数据库版本:MySQL 5.6.26线上某业务表为了区分大小写,使用BINARY关键字,正常来说使用这个关键字是走索引的,测试过程如下:创建测试表,插入数据:drop table if EXISTS...
2017-11-20 10:20:59 654
转载 Mycat部署与使用
MyCAT 可以视为“MySQL”集群的企业级数据库,用来替代昂贵的Oracle集群,其背后是阿里曾经开源的知名产品Cobar。MyCAT的目标是:低成本的将现有的单机数据库和应用平滑迁移到“云”端,解决数据存储和业务规模...
2017-03-09 15:27:09 194
转载 MHA搭建及故障维护
MHA是一种方便简单可靠的MySQL高可用架构,具体的介绍我在这里就不多说了,下面是我在网上找的一个教程,我在此基础上进行了一些修改: 大致步骤(一)、环境介绍(二)、用ssh-keygen实现四台...
2017-03-02 09:43:02 357
转载 MySQL添加外键失败ERROR 1452的解决
今天在学习数据库添加外键的时候,遇到了问题我先创建了两个表 orders 和 order_items ,存储引擎都是InnoDB,且都有orderid这个属性(类型完全一样),但是我使用命令[sql] ...
2016-06-22 11:14:50 212
转载 MySQL 5.7修改忘记root密码
MySQL 5.7 mysql库的user表中已经不再有password字段,取而代之的为authentication_string修改语法相同,步骤也相同。注意:/etc/my.cnf这个配置文件中,based...
2016-02-29 16:38:56 175
转载 MySQL unsigned属性
整数类型有可选的UNSIGNED属性,表示不充许负值,这大致上可以使正数的上限提高一倍可以使用这几种整数类型:TINYINT,SMALLINT,MEDIUMINT,INT,BIGINT。分别使用8,16,24,32,64位存...
2016-02-25 14:06:15 155
转载 ETL工具----Kettle快速入门
不论是数据仓库还是大数据,都需要用到ETL工具。ETL(Extract-Transform-Load的缩写,即数据抽取、转换、装载的过程) 1、Kettle概念 Kettle是一款国外开源的E...
2016-01-27 17:21:46 185
转载 MySQL数据导入到infobright中
1. 在mysql中建一张表:mysql> create table guoqing( -> id int, -> guo char(10), ->...
2016-01-26 16:05:40 245
转载 MongoDB 3.0.8 权限管理
MongoDB 3.0虽然管理上有所改变,但是还是没有太明显。千万不要相信百度上各种,3.0起没有root用户,授个userAdminAnyDatabase角色权限的用户就是root用户。不然用客户端连接会报下面一些错误...
2016-01-24 17:21:36 198
转载 CentOS 6.3下快速安装MongoDB 3.2.1
MongoDB是一个基于分布式文件存储的数据库。由C++语言编写。旨在为WEB应用提供可扩展的高性能数据存储解决方案。是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。他支持的...
2016-01-21 18:10:07 89
转载 MySQL提示:The server quit without updating PID file(…)失败
重新启动MySQL数据库出错 原因 [root@guoqing mysql]# service mysql restartMySQL server PID file coul...
2016-01-15 13:17:20 76
转载 CentOS 6.3 安装MySQL-5.7.10
MySQL的安装分为三种:1、RPM包安装;2、二进制包安装;3、源码安装。第一种方式比较简单,直接RPM包安装就OK了,或者通过yum源来安装,但无...
2016-01-13 14:16:16 104
转载 MySQL binlog日期解析
由于业务环境中MySQL 二进制日志复制是基于行的,昨天开发跑过来让查询有没有人对库进行过插入操作用mysqlbinlog 工具查询出来的日志全是base-64编码的信息。这是因为从MySQL 5.1开始,binlog支...
2016-01-12 10:38:59 514
转载 未提交事务造成的等待事件
开发人员过来说程序中无法修改数据ERROR 1205 (HY000): Lock wait timeout exceeded; try restarting transaction 查看是如下SQL语句造成的...
2016-01-06 13:34:03 96
转载 安装sysbench报错 libmysqlclient.so.18()(64bit)
安装sysbench报如下错误[root@mysql mysql]# rpm -ivh sysbench-0.5-2.el6_.x86_64.rpm...
2016-01-04 15:23:40 1114
转载 修改MySQL字符集
二进制方式安装的MySQL当时没注意字符集问题,后来在建表的时候发现默认字符集是latin1建个ting表mysql> create table ting(id int);Query OK, 0 rows af...
2015-12-24 17:15:42 77
转载 深度分析数据库的热点块问题
热点块的定义 数据库的热点块,从简单了讲,就是极短的时间内对少量数据块进行了过于频繁的访问。定义看起来总是很简单的,但实际在数据库中,我们要去观察或者确定热点块的问题,却不是那么简单了。...
2015-11-19 16:02:51 125
转载 Oracle DataGuard跨平台支持列表
Oracle支持在某些平台之间,进行跨平台的Dataguard环境架设,虽然存在这样一种可能性,但是选择这样的解决方案时,应当极为慎重。例如如下列表中就有因为Bug撤出支持序列的情况存在(This is not...
2015-10-10 15:23:22 266
转载 Shared Everything、share-nothing、Shared Disk区别
数据库构架设计中主要有Shared Everthting、Shared Nothing、和Shared Disk: Shared Ev...
2015-10-10 11:16:51 880
转载 Centos64位6.3 下安装 Mysql5.6
MySQL的安装分为三种:1、RPM包安装;2、二进制包安装;3、源码安装。 第一种方式比较简单,直接RPM包安装就OK了,或者通过yum源来安装,一般rpm包安装不支持自定义目录而第三种方式比较复杂。一...
2015-09-22 13:35:33 77
转载 error:package mysql-client is not relocatable
rpm -ivh MySQL-client-5.5.17-1.linux2.6.i386.rpm --prefix=/mysql提示错误:error:package mysql-client is not relocat...
2015-09-22 13:32:15 1014
转载 MySql提示:The server quit without updating PID file(…)失败
MySql提示:The server quit without updating PID file(…)失败服务器症状:今天网站web页面提交内容到数据库,发现出错了,一直提交不了,数找了下原因,发现数据写不进去...
2015-09-21 11:11:19 76
转载 ERROR 157 (HY000): Could not connect to storage en
ERROR 157 (HY000): Could not connect to storage en在mysql集群中创建了一个新库,但是无法创建表,提示找不到存储引擎。ERROR 157 (HY000): ...
2015-09-16 14:27:23 615
转载 MySQL cluster 7.2集群部署配置
MySQL cluster 7.2集群部署配置本文主要介绍在CentOS 6.3系统上搭建MySQL cluster 7.2.10集群的方法。1. MySQL cluster简介MySQL clust...
2015-09-16 14:24:56 75
转载 Xtrabackup实现数据库备份和灾难恢复
Percona Xtrabackup实现数据库备份和灾难恢复1、工具介绍2、工具安装3、备份策略及准备测试数据4、全备份数据5、增量备份数据6、灾难恢复7、总结1、工具介绍percon...
2015-09-14 11:05:35 118
转载 MySQL基于binlog主从复制配置
Master-Slave 搭建环境:Master:Os: rhel-server-6.3-x86_64Mysql: MySQL -5.5.35-1虚拟机:Virtual BOXIp:192.168.56....
2015-09-11 10:40:12 89
转载 ORA-06054探究
ORA-06054异机恢复经典的错误,06054找的是current redo也就是备份完成那一时刻的current 状态的在线日志, RMAN是不备份online redo log的,所以恢复也...
2015-06-09 16:02:54 501
转载 latch:cache buffers chains的优化思路
数据块在buffer cache存放是以linked list(链表)方式存放的。当一个session想要访问/修改buffer cache的block,首先需要通过hash算法检查该block是否存在于buffer...
2015-06-09 13:50:30 101
转载 数据库内存抖动
在数据库巡检的过程中,发现在AWR报告中(该报告的采集间隔为1小时),两个采集点的Buffer Cache和Shared Pool Size发生了较大变化: 接着查询v$SGA_RESIZ...
2015-06-07 18:09:52 226
转载 在线迁移表空间数据文件
先移test_tbs 表空间 test_tbs.dbf文件 SYS@PROD1 > col name for a60 SYS@PROD1 >select name,file# from...
2015-05-28 17:24:56 137
转载 Data Guard 之RMAN备份在线搭建物理standby
此种方式搭建DG,不需要停止主库,极大提高了生产库的可用性。 一、大致步骤 通过RMAN备份创建standby数据库大致分为这几个步骤: (1)设置主数据...
2015-05-27 17:19:19 261
转载 0级备份和全备份的本质区别
准备:将测试环境的users表空间只读测试:1、数据库0级别备份RMAN> backup incremental level 0 database tag 'levle0' format '/home/ora...
2015-05-23 23:40:24 136
转载 0级备份和全备份的本质区别
准备:将测试环境的users表空间只读测试:1、数据库0级别备份RMAN> backup incremental level 0 database tag 'levle0' format '/home/ora...
2015-05-23 23:40:03 737
转载 逻辑卷创建、扩容、删除
新建逻辑卷 第一步:创建分区:sdb1 、sdb2 、sdb3等 [root@guo ~]# fdisk /dev/sdb 第二步:将物理分区创建为物理卷(pvcr...
2015-05-22 00:15:15 115
转载 利用BBED修改数据块SCN----极端环境下的数据恢复
破坏system表空间文件 ----比较暴力做前需做好备份cd $ORACLE_BASE/oradata/PROD1cp system01.dbf system01.dbf.bak切日志模拟生产交易,更...
2015-05-19 13:49:49 181
转载 BBED简介
BBED(Oracle Block Browerand EDitor Tool),用来直接查看和修改数据文 件数据的一个工具,是Oracle一款内部工具,可以直接修改Oracle数据文件 块的内...
2015-05-19 10:15:33 187
转载 fast_start_mttr_target快速启动平均故障恢复的时间
当我们和boss签合同时,有个参数非常重要:fast_start_mttr_target 1 fast_start_mttr_target:快速启动平均故障恢复的时...
2015-05-03 17:08:18 109
转载 oracle 的服务器进程(PMON, SMON,CKPT,DBWn,LGWR,ARCn)
PMON PMON,进程监视。PMON主要有3个用途: 1,在进程非正常中断后,做清理工作。例如:dedicated server失败了或者因为一些原因被杀死,这是PMON的...
2015-05-01 00:20:35 236
转载 ORACLE中的DB_NAME,SERVICE_NAME,INSTANCE_NAME,ORACLE_SID,GLOBAL_DBNAME介绍
最近查过一些资料,准备把oracle里纷乱的参数整理一下,这里主要讨论以下参数,及其用法的总结,如有不对的地方,望...
2015-05-01 00:13:47 428
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人